Transaction 2f5bec723a5032db90c82010495513934addecf5a1f5a40ba0bb39b86fd72a19

3 Input
2 Outputs
  • 2f5bec723a5032db90c82010495513934addecf5a1f5a40ba0bb39b86fd72a19:0
  • value  1000004
    address  32H5cHpCu1QXYfrhLNs4cokgCSzRYRHd2F
  • 2f5bec723a5032db90c82010495513934addecf5a1f5a40ba0bb39b86fd72a19:1
  • value  398909
    address  1DUN7ntwtsqGMjWJeMs2uLY81gvrGTHU1c